Introduction to nxosv-final.9.2.1.box Software

​nxosv-final.9.2.1.box​​ is a preconfigured virtual machine image for Cisco Nexus 9000 Series NX-OSv software version 9.2(1), designed for network simulation and testing in virtualized environments. This Vagrant-compatible package enables network engineers to emulate Cisco Nexus switch functionality on VMware ESXi 7.0 U3+ or VirtualBox 6.1+ platforms, supporting feature validation for data center automation workflows.

The 9.2(1) release aligns with Cisco’s NX-OS 9.2(x) feature set, providing parity with physical Nexus 9300-EX/FX series switches. Official documentation highlights its use cases in multi-vendor network simulations and CI/CD pipeline testing.
